Police Apprehends Fugitive Kapena Bus Services Driver

Police has apprehended the Kapena bus services driver who escaped after a road accident on the Great East road that claimed 17 lives.

Police Spokesperson Esther Katongo says the driver will soon be charged with 17 counts of causing death by dangerous driving.

Meanwhile the Road Transport and Safety Agency-RTSA says it will decide on the course of action to be taken against Kapena bus services by next week.

Of the 17 bodies 13 have been identified and postmortem has since been conducted.
